As well as core health areas VHS is involved in other policy topics including, volunteering in NHS Scotland and action for health literacy. We co-convene the Health Policy Officers Network with The Queen’s Nursing Institute Scotland
VHS is a member of the National Group for the Volunteering in NHS Scotland programme, a strategic group that oversees the development of activities, provides leadership to the programme and engages with the Scottish Government.
VHS is also a member of the Scottish Government health literacy action plan implementation group.
